What is 1.Manpower Planning
Involves HR Manager comparing how many workers a business needs in future with how many are currently employed and then recruiting/making redundancies as needed to ensure that the business has exactly the tight number of skilled workers to do all the jobs needed in the business so it can achieve its goals
Manpower Planning steps
1.Forecast Future Demand
2.Calculate Existing Supply
3.Recruit/Make redundancies
Benefits of 1.Manpower planning
-Avoids being understaffed
-Avoids being overstaffed

What is 3.Training and Development
HRM teaches the employees the knowledge akills, and attitude they need to perform the duties of their jobs properly
Name the three diff types of training
Induction training
ON THE JOB training
OFF THE JOB training
What is induction training
Very first training given to a new employee
Familiarises her with business
What is ONT THE JOB trauning
teaching the employee the knowledge skills and attitude needed to do the job well WHILE SHES IN THE NOTMAL WORKING SITUATION.
Employee learns through practical experience
Job rotation (1week per area of the job)
E.g 1week making chips
1 week on tills
1 week making pizza
Whats OFF THE JOB training
Teaching the employee the knowledge skills and attitude needed to do the job well, AWAY FROM THE WORKING SITUATUON.
What is development
Teaching employees life long skills and knoledge to help them grow as an individual
More than training
Development teaches them skills they can use in any job
Benefits oF TRAINING and DEVELOPMENT
Teaches workers skills needed to do a great job. Increases sales and profits
Gives workers a variety of skills and makes them more flexible
Properly trained workers need less supervision
Doing ur job well leads to less conflict. Improves industrial relations
